Comparative Analysis

Lifecycle Comparison: Pitcher Plant vs. True Annuals 🌱

Pitcher plants are perennial, meaning they live for multiple years, unlike true annuals that complete their lifecycle in just one season. This longevity allows pitcher plants to develop complex structures and strategies for survival, while annuals must rush through growth and reproduction.

In terms of growth and reproductive timing, pitcher plants typically flower in late spring or summer, aligning with their active growth phase. True annuals, on the other hand, often bloom and set seeds within a few months, racing against the clock to ensure their lineage continues.

Management Tips for Gardeners

🌱 Best Practices for Maintaining Pitcher Plant

To thrive, pitcher plants require specific soil conditions. They prefer acidic, nutrient-poor substrates, which mimic their natural habitats.

Watering is equally crucial. Ensure consistent moisture without waterlogging, as excess water can lead to root rot.
